
The Sun reports that exes Kendall Jenner and Harry Styles are finding comfort in one another as they deal with their very own separate breakups. Friends of Styles claimed to the outlet that he and Jenner have been “leaning on one another” for the previous couple of weeks.
Jenner quietly broke up along with her NBA player on-off boyfriend Devin Booker last month. Styles is currently “on a break” with Olivia Wilde, whom he dated for nearly two years. Jenner and Styles themselves dated back in late 2013 and early 2014. They later sparked dating rumors again once they reunited in December 2015 to go on holiday in Anguilla. They got handsy on a yacht then, but no larger reconciliation got here out of it.
The 2 remained friendly enough though to seem on the Late Late Show together when Styles guest hosted in December 2019.

Regarding their connection now, a Los Angeles source told The Sun, “Harry and Kendall have at all times stayed in contact, but in light of their recent splits, they’ve more time for each other. And Harry has had Kendall’s ear over his break-up with Olivia.”
“Kendall is considered one of the few people to know the extent of fame and scrutiny which Harry endures,” the source continued. “She can be dealing along with her own tough time [with her own breakup].”
Don’t expect Styles and Jenner to rebound with one another though. The outlet added that while the 2 are “very alike,” their busy lifestyles just would not make anything greater than friendship work easily.
It’s price noting that Styles and Jenner each ended things with their ex-partners due to schedule differences caused partially by their careers as a musician touring the world (Styles) and model occasionally traveling the world for fashion week and shoots (Jenner).
One source told People of Jenner’s breakup from Booker, “Each have incredibly busy schedules at once with their careers and so they’ve decided to make that a priority. They’ve loads of love and respect for one another and need only the very best.”
One other source told Entertainment Tonight regarding Styles and Wilde’s decision to go on a break, “They made the choice to call it quits just a few weeks ago but they really do love spending time together. He’s gearing up for the international leg of his tour next week, so this was a fitting time to go their separate ways.”
